Vita/Bio:

Master's degree in Rehabilitation Counseling, Assumption College, and Certified Work Incentive Counselor, with over 30 years’ experience in the field of community rehabilitation and employment of people with disabilities. Currently Coordinator-Access to Integrated Employment and Director for the Work Incentive Planning and Assistance (WIPA) CT and RI Program, Paul V. Sherlock Center on Disabilities, RI College, a UCEDD. Former Adjunct Faculty, Salve Regina University- RHB-550 Vocational Rehabilitation and Employment.  Since 1994, provided disability employment-related training, information development and dissemination, and technical assistance. Coordinator and trainer, Supporting Meaningful Employment an ACRE-endorsed Basic Employment Services curriculum. Coordinated employment-related system change grants as well as pilot initiatives.  Extensive survey development, data collection, and reporting experience, www.rioutcomesurveys.info Coordinator of 3 statewide employment professional development groups. Member of several state committees and advisory boards related to the employment of people with disabilities, including RI APSE Chapter and ACRE, and Chair, the Medicaid for the Working Disabled Work Group.
